Hello, I'm 38 year non technical professional and already working in reputed technical company and would like to move to web development side, Is too late to start this journey as I've to learn Programming Language. My company asked me to through Salesforce Administration/Developers modules as start. I would like to know what are the skills i need to acquire to become good SF developers? Is programming language mandatory to become SF developer. Any suggestion and guidance is really appreciated.

Hi Nirmala, First of all, age is no bar in learning and developing new skills. Also, learning programming and coding could be fun. Whether programming is a requirement to start working as a Salesforce developer: It mostly depends on the job profile but in general they say that prior programming experience is not required to start working on Salesforce. One can directly start working on Salesforce and learn it's proprietary coding languageslanguages on the job. It might be easier to work on Salesforce development if one has prior knowledge of Java and SQL. I always recommend that everyone (whether in programming or not) should learn atleast one procedural programming language. read less
